DOE large horizontal-axis wind-turbine development at NASA Lewis Research Center

The large wind-turbine program is a major segment of the Federal Wind Energy Program sponsored by the Department of Energy (DOE). The NASA Lewis Research Center manages the large horizontal axis wind turbine program for DOE. The large wind turbine program is directed toward development of the technology for safe, reliable, environmentally acceptable large wind turbines that have the potential to generate a significant amount of electricity at costs competitive with conventional electric generation systems. In addition, these large wind turbines must be fully compatible with electric utility operations and interface requirements. There are several ongoing large wind system development projects directed toward meeting the technology requirements for utility applications. The first generation technology machines (Mod-0A and Mod-1) successfully completed their planned periods of experimental operation in June 1982. The second generation machines (Mod-2) are in operation at selected utility sites. Third generation technology machines (Mod-5) are in the design phase and are planned for initial operation in late 1984 or early 1985. Each successive generation of technology has shown potential to increase reliability and energy capture, while reducing the cost of electricity. These advances are being made by gaining a better understanding of the system-design drivers, improvements in the analytical design tools, verification of design methods with operating field data, and the incorporation of new technology and innovative designs. This paper provides an overview of the large wind turbine activities managed by NASA Lewis. These activities include results from the first and second generation field machines (Mod-0A, -1, and -2), the status of the Department of Interior WTS-4 machine for which NASA is responsible for technical management, and the design phase of the third generation wind turbines (Mod-5).
